Gantry-Type Machining Systems
Gantry Style machining machines offer considerable perks for a diverse array of production applications .
These robust machines feature a moving gantry framework that furnishes exceptional precision and workpiece backing . This configuration permits for substantial parts to be machined with superior accuracy .
- Minimized shaking and improved surface finish .
- Greater throughput due to larger securing abilities .
- Optimized adaptability for working with multiple component sizes .
- Capability to machine complex geometries successfully.
Common purposes include cutting of oversized die foundations , turbine parts , and aerospace frame parts . They are particularly well-suited for facilities that require extreme levels of precision and capacity .

Analyzing CNC Milling Centers: Boring , Grinding and Bridge Types
When choosing a CNC milling center, understanding the variations between boring , milling , and portal types is essential . Drilling machines excel in creating substantial holes, often with exactness, and are employed for specific applications. Shaping centers offer more flexibility for creating intricate parts with multiple features. Finally, portal style machines offer remarkable workpiece stability and extension , permitting them perfect for handling large components or performing multiple operations in a single setup.
